The Design and PerformanceAnalysis of Friction DiskType Limited Slip Differential

Time:DEC 16-18, 2011.; Aiming at the ability to adapt to different road conditions of limited-slip differential(LSD) in drive axle, by building the without preloadingfriction disk type limited slip differentialmechanical model, We derive the theoretical formula of the locking differential coefficient of the theoretical formula of limited slip differential without preload friction disk from mathematical theory derivation, and fitted theoretical curves, Which can be used as reference for further studies on other limited slip differential. Experimental verification was applied to the designed drive axle, experimental results shows that, the actual performance parameters of each drive axle design values consistent with the theory, to prove the correctness of the theoretical derivation, proved the correctness of theoretical analysis.
